I created a background using my Gelatos and Faber-Castell Glaze. The glaze acts as a resist to the Mango Gelato painted over top. The contrast is amazing!

If you look closely, you can see the brush marks of Gesso on my bird. The gesso helps the Artist Big Brush pens to become very blendable. These pens are India ink and very different from Copics or waterbase markers. While wet, you can blend using your finger. Once dry, they become permanent.
